Pulmonary sequestration in adults: a retrospective review of resected and unresected cases
Abstract Background Pulmonary sequestration (PS) is a form of congenital pulmonary malformation that is generally diagnosed in childhood or adolescence and usually resected when diagnosed. We aim to identify the clinical presentation and course of patients diagnosed to have PS during adulthood. Meth...
